Greek Lima Beans Pressure Cooker Recipe

Ingredients

SERVES 4 – Cooker: 5- to 7-quart – Time: 3 minutes at HIGH pressure

  • 1 (10-ounce) package frozen baby lima beans (no need to thaw)
  • 2 tablespoons coarsely chopped fresh flatleaf parsley
  • 1 tablespoon minced garlic
  • ½ teaspoon sea salt, plus more to taste
  • 1 cup vegetable broth or water
  • 2 to 3 tablespoons good-quality olive oil, to taste
  • freshly ground black pepper
  • 1 lemon, halved or quartered, plus wedges for serving

Method

  1. Place the lima beans, parsley, garlic, and ½ teaspoon salt in a 5- to 7-quart pressure cooker
  2. Add the broth and oil
  3. Bring to a boil
  4. Close and lock the lid
  5. Set the burner heat to high
  6. When the cooker reaches HIGH pressure, reduce the burner heat as low as you can and still maintain HIGH pressure
  7. Set a timer to cook for 3 minutes
  8. Remove the pot from the heat and let stand a few minutes
  9. Open the cooker with the Quick Release method
  10. Be careful of the steam as you remove the lid
  11. The beans should be tender when pierced with the tip of a knife
  12. If the beans are not totally cooked, cover the pot and cook without pressure for a few minutes over medium heat
  13. Stir, season to taste with salt and pepper, and squeeze in the juice from halved or quartered lemon
  14. Serve immediately with lemon wedges, if you like
